[* black] Insert the flat tip of the metal spudger into the seam of between the back panel and the screen.
-[* icon_note] It is easiest to get the spudger into the seam at the corners of the device.
-[* black] Slide the spudger across the perimeter of the device and pry gently at each corner.
-[* icon_caution] When screen is successfully separated from back panel, there are still two connected ribbon cables between the two components. These cables must be disconnected before further disassembly.
